  2. To cover just a room may in fact be $800 but when a new roof is installed on a home it covers the entire house not just one room. If the roof over the balance of your home is worn out then a complete re-roof might be called for and they can run in the thousands due to the labor involved in tearing off and disposing of the old shingles, repairing any rotten wood and then replacing the felt paper under the shingles, the shingles , metal flashings and the haul away of the old shingles. Roof pricing also depends on the height and steepness of your roof. While the portion of the roof above this bedroom is flat the rest of your roof may have a steep slant to it and this takes more time to shingle and we all know that time is money. You've done well up to this point calling in several roofers for competitive estimates but to just handle the flat portion over the bedroom is a "repair" and repairs can run anywhere from $125-$800 or more.
  3. $225 per square (100 square feet) for 25 year fiberglass shingles on roof pitches greater than 4/12 (includes tear off and new flashings, drip edge, ridge vent). So a 40 square job would run around $10,000.

Metal roofing is more expencive than asphalt shingles but less than wood(cedar) shingles. a- average price for three tab shingle remove and replace $250.00 per square (square= 100square feet you're "sf" is 196sf or2 square) this only includes r+r . b- average for metal roofing r+r $300.00 to$500.00 per square, as before that only includes r+r. c- average for cedar roofing is $500.00 to $700.00 per square and as before. 2.now after they remove the roof it goes to the dumpster about $200.00. a- nows the bugger (cost per ton construction debree) this can vary regionaly, in my area it is $50.00 per ton, new england 3. if your roof was leaking it is a very good chance that there is wood damage ie. sub roof, rafters or joist rot any insulation that is in there should be replaced as it may black mold up on you 4.call your local b.b.b. and have them recomend a roofer or call ,if you have one , the local home builders associastion both of these keep track of the roofers business practices also if your state requires lisences you can check the out on the state lisencesure link. 5. when you get bids ,I recomend getting at least 5 bids as this will show the con men better than anything a-low estimates are scary you know something is wrong and high the guy is greedy b-take the higher middle of the road guy, and ASK FOR REFRENCES this is the only way to truely check him out c- never pay more than 30% up front . 6. have a male friend or brother or dad whatever be their it works hope this helps joe ps my spell check seems to be broken
